One of several bow brooches in the Queen's collection, the Lover's Knot brooch was created by Garrard and acquired by Queen Mary, the Queen's grandmother, in 1932. The Cullinan VIII is the emerald-cut 6.8 carat diamond on top, and Cullinan VI is the 11.5 carat marquise diamond that acts as a pendant. Perhaps the most sentimental of all the jewels handed down to the Queen from her great-grandmother, this oval sapphire brooch with a surround of 12 round mine-cut diamonds was a gift from Prince Albert to Victoria, the day before their wedding on 9 February 1840.
